10. Given f(x) > 0 with f '(x) < 0, and f "(x) > 0 for all x in the interval [0, 2] with f(0) = 1 and f(2)= 0.2, the left, right, trapezoidal, and midpoint rule approximations were used to estimate = {f(x)dx. The estimates were 0.7811, 0.8675, 0.8650, 0.8632 and 0.9540, and the same number of subintervals were used in each case. Match the rule to its estimate. 1. left endpoint 2. actual area 3. trapezoidal 4. midpoint 5. right endpoint a. 0.9540 b. 0.7811 c. 0.8632 d. 0.8675 e. 0.8650
